The 2026 season was a controlled experiment nobody ordered. The league was suspended, returned on a compressed calendar, and most matches were played in empty stadiums. My sample contains 156 matches with footage good enough to analyse. That is large enough to ask a question. It is not large enough to call the answer final.

Three layers of data

Layer one is outcomes. The 46% home win rate of the 2026 season fell to 38%. Where did the difference go? Not into away wins — that share barely moved. It went into draws, and into a cluster of matches where the home team scored first and failed to hold the result to the final whistle.

Layer two is process. Away teams' first-half PPDA fell sharply: they pressed higher, earlier, and in areas they used to concede. Per match, away sides contested roughly nine more duels in the attacking third than they did in 2026. Home teams did not pass the ball worse in a linear way. They passed it worse in exactly the opening 15 minutes, then levelled out.

Layer three is set pieces. Penalties awarded to home teams declined. Yellow cards shown to away teams inside the box declined. I have no evidence of referee bias, and I will not claim any. But I do have evidence that, without the pressure of forty thousand voices, decisions in sensitive areas were made in a different information environment.

I also tested the xG layer. Home teams' total xG dipped slightly; away teams' total xG rose far more — a net gap of roughly 0.21 goals per match in the visitors' favour. It sounds small. Multiply it by 156 matches and it is more than thirty goals changing hands, none of which ever appeared on a scoreboard.

The contrarian angle: the crowd is not the central variable

The easiest conclusion, and the one most coverage reached, is that crowds create psychological advantage, and losing them means losing that edge. It reads smoothly. I think it is wrong about the central role.

2026 did not only lose spectators. It lost flights, a normal calendar, recovery rhythm, and the real home ground itself — some "home" fixtures were played at neutral venues for public-health reasons. I recalculated with the neutral-venue group stripped out. The drop survived, but shrank from eight percentage points to about five.

The remaining five points do not come from fear in the home team. They come from aggression in the away team. That is a difference in mechanism, and mechanism matters more than magnitude. Fear takes time to cure — it needs psychology, needs leadership. Aggression needs one tactical decision and one week of training.

The signal for the next cycle

I am not forecasting that the home win rate stays at 38%. It will recover as stands reopen, though probably not all the way back to 46%. My margin of error is plus or minus four percentage points, on the assumption that the calendar returns to normal. If the calendar stays compressed, the number lands between the two marks.

The indicator I will track from here is home teams' pass completion in the opening 15 minutes. In 2026 that figure was 6.2 percentage points higher than their opening 15 minutes away from home. In 2026 the gap was effectively zero. If that gap reopens, home advantage has come back. If it does not, we are reading Vietnamese football off an old map — and every forecast drawn from that map is mispricing the cost of a single shout.
